In recent years, there has been a troubling increase in drug-related deaths throughout California, including Los Angeles County, where Beverly Hills is located. According to data obtained from the 2020 National Survey of Drug Use and Health:

  • Young adults aged 18 to 25 had the highest percentage of people with alcohol use disorders (15.6% or 5.2 million people), followed by adults aged 26 and older (10.3% or 22.4 million people), and adolescents aged 12 to 17 (2.8% or 712,000 people).
  • A substance use disorder affected 40.3 million individuals aged 12 and over (or 14.5 percent) in 2020.
  • There was a significantly lower rate of treatment seeking among adults with substance use disorders or co-occurring substance use disorders and mental illness. Over 90% of them did not receive treatment in the past year.

Does Drug Addiction Affect Men Differently Than Women?

According to data published by the National Institute on Drug Abuse in 2020, there are many significant ways in which men are affected disproportionately or uniquely by drug and alcohol addiction.

While most research shows that men and women have relatively comparable outcomes once they seek professional treatment, men are more likely to experience sufficient social support once they enter treatment. There are also some indications that while most treatments have a similar rate of effectiveness in both men and women, the specific treatment for cocaine use that involves disulfiram has been measured as more effective in men with a cocaine addiction than in women. Additionally, men that are treated with naltrexone for their alcohol use disorder often do not have the same degree of recovery as women.

Recent research has shown, among other things, that:

  • Men are more prone to and have higher documented rates of, binge drinking
  • When heroin is being used, men are more likely to inject it than women
  • When heroin is used, men are more likely to use larger amounts or take the drug more frequently than women
  • Men are more likely to seek treatment for heroin addiction
  • Men who become addicted to marijuana are more likely to develop a co-occurring antisocial personality disorder
  • Men who become addicted to marijuana are more likely to develop multiple other substance use disorders
  • Men who use marijuana in high school are likely to have more problems with their family relationships, as well as more problems in school than women who use marijuana in high school
  • Men are more likely to experience an overdose situation than women as a result of illegal drug use
  • Men are more likely to end up in the ER as a result of their addiction

What Types Of Programs Are Available In Men’s Drug Rehab?

There are several types of men’s drug rehab programs that can be found in leading rehab centers. There are three primary types of treatment programs, detox, inpatient, and outpatient.

Detox

Entering a detox program is entering into a residential setting where the individual can be monitored during their detox and acute withdrawal stage. This is generally used as the first step to a well-rounded treatment plan and allows the patient to let the drugs or alcohol leave their system in a safe and comfortable environment. When the patient is medically stable and out of the acute withdrawal stage, they will often be ready to begin either a long-term or a short-term inpatient treatment program to begin their recovery and relapse prevention programming.

Inpatient treatment programs are often called residential programs, as the patient will live completely at the treatment center for the duration of the treatment, and will check out after it has concluded. The patient will wake up each day and have breakfast, then spend a large portion of their day participating in individual and group therapy, counseling sessions, and addiction education programs, breaking for lunch.

After lunch, more recovery programming will continue until the early evening. The day’s programming will generally conclude before dinner, and following dinner will often be support groups or social discussion time, as well as personal time for the patients to reflect on the day and prepare for the next. Inpatient programs will often last at least a few weeks but can be as long as a few months, depending on the needs of the patient.

Outpatient treatment programs are one of the most flexible ways for men to continue their treatment and recovery, while also maintaining a job or going to school, and living independently or at a sober living facility. Outpatient programs will require the patient to travel to the treatment center at least once per week, to participate in counseling and additional treatment. 

Depending on the needs of the patient, more intensive outpatient programs can be created as well. Some patients may find that 3 visits a week for 3-4 hours each is the level of treatment they feel they need. This can be adjusted as often as needed, in alignment with the opinion of the doctors and clinicians, and the needs of the patient. Frequently attending support groups or 12-step meetings is a component of outpatient programs of all intensity levels.

Outpatient programs are often used as a step-down treatment for those leaving inpatient treatment who will need some level of continuing care.

Is Specialized Drug Rehab For Men Available?

One of the biggest reasons that men often seek treatment in a male-only setting is due to the perceived social stigma in seeking help with mental health, in the form of treating co-occurring disorders. Co-occurring disorders are other conditions or disorders, commonly mental disorders, that are present simultaneously with drug or alcohol addiction.

Specialized, gender-specific care is available in the form of men’s drug rehab.

Traditionally, men are seen as weak or lesser for seeking help with mental health issues, and while we know this is not only unrealistic but dangerous, many men are still hesitant to seek professional treatment for non-physical conditions. It is important to remember that nobody is ever weak or lesser than another person for choosing to take better care of their health, whether physical or mental.

Co-occurring disorders can be incredibly hard to diagnose and treat, outside of a detox and inpatient rehab situation. The reason is that when the patient isn’t detoxed, the side effects of the substance use can mask or alter the symptoms of the undiagnosed mental illness, just as the symptoms of mental illness can also mask the signs of potential drug abuse. To combat this, the most effective treatments for co-occurring disorders are those that treat all disorders at the same time.
